In the UK's sustainable robotics sector, several key roles are driving innovation and growth. Here is a data-driven visualization displaying the prevalence of these roles in the current market: 1. **Sustainable Robotics Engineer (45%)** These professionals focus on designing, building, and maintaining eco-friendly robots that contribute to a greener future. Their expertise lies in understanding the intricacies of sustainable materials and energy-efficient technologies. 2. **Robotics Technician (26%)** Robotics technicians are responsible for installing, operating, and repairing robotic systems. In the context of sustainable robotics, they ensure the efficient use of resources and the minimization of waste throughout the robot's lifecycle. 3. **Automation Specialist (15%)** Automation specialists deal with the integration of robotics into various industries to optimize processes, reduce human intervention, and enhance overall sustainability. Their expertise lies in identifying areas where automation can deliver the most significant environmental benefits. 4. **Robotics Software Developer (14%)** Robotics software developers design, create, and maintain software applications that control robots' behavior and functionality. In sustainable robotics, they focus on developing energy-efficient algorithms and minimizing the carbon footprint of robotics operations.
